NASCAR Coca-Cola 600 Takes Checkered Flag Over Indianapolis 500

In a battle of big races, the NASCAR Coca-Cola 600 edged the Indianapolis 500 to take the sports ratings checkered flag for the week of May 19-25, 2008 with a viewership of 7.584 million. Remember when the Indianapolis 500 was a big event? I do. Not so much anymore, but it still managed an audience of 7.245 million.

They both lead a field of seven NBA Playoff games topped by the May 19th’s Spurs/Hornets conference semi-final game 7. Luckily for the NBA Finals ratings, the Lakers have beaten the solid but ratings killing Spurs to advance to the NBA finals. Now, if the Celtics can just hang on to beat the Pistons, the NBA, like the NHL, will have its Finals dream (ratings) match up.

Top Sports Shows for the Week of May 19-25, 2008:


RANK PROGRAMS Network Persons Live+SD (000) HH Rating Live+SD
1 NASCAR SPRINT CUP COCA-COLA 600 FOX 7,584 4.7
2 INDIANAPOLIS 500 5/25 ABC 7,245 4.6
3 NBA PLAYOFFS (SPURS/HORNETS) TNT 6,547 4.3
4 NBA PLAYOFFS (SPURS/LAKERS) TNT 6,190 4.1
5 NBA PLAYOFFS (LAKERS/SPURS) TNT 5,729 3.7
6 NBA PLAYOFFS (PISTONS/CELTICS) ESPN 5,698 3.9
7 NBA PLAYOFFS (SPURS/LAKERS) TNT 5,513 3.7
8 NBA BOSTON/DETROIT-SAT 5/24 ABC 5,454 3.7
9 NBA PLAYOFFS (PISTONS/CELTICS) ESPN 5,431 3.7
10 WWE RAW USA 4,742 2.8
11 WWE RAW USA 4,449 2.7
12 FOX NASCAR SPRINT PRE FOX 4,401 2.8
13 FRIDAY NIGHT SMACKDOWN CW 4,170 2.4
14 INDIANAPOLIS 500 PRE-RACE 5/25 ABC 3,159 2.2
15 NBA PLAYOFFS PRE-GAME FRI TNT 2,927 2.0
16 INSIDE THE NBA PLAYOFFS MON TNT 2,790 2.0
17 INSIDE THE NBA PLAYOFFS WED TNT 2,684 2.0
18 FOX SATURDAY BASEBALL (VARIOUS) FOX 2,399 1.7
19 GMC NBA SAT 5/24 ABC 2,326 1.7
20 COLONIAL GOLF SUN 5/25 CBS 2,253 1.7

As usual the faux wrestling shows of WWE Raw were in the top 20 at #10 and #11 with 4.7 and 4.4 million viewers respectively. Their broadcast relative, Friday Night Smackdown came in at #13 with 4.2 million viewers.

Major League Baseball put one game in the top 20 at #18 with 2.4 million viewers.

No NHL Playoff games made the top 20 (but only because of the way we receive data from Nielsen, see below), but expect that to change when the current week’s results are in. The Detroit/Pittsburgh Finals have been a ratings winner.

PGA golf placed the Sunday action at the Colonial at #20 with 2.2 million viewers.

Our Sports Ratings combine the top Broadcast sports shows and any cable sports shows that appeared in the top 40 cable programs. It is possible that a cable sports show that had enough viewers to make this list is left off because it didn’t have enough viewers to make the list of the top 40 cable programs for the week which is all we have access to.
